Title
On-line Load Optimization for Two Way Load Management System

Abstract
In this paper, an optimization approach is proposed for the control center in the two way load management system to coordinate the direct control of a large number of central chillers. The optimization approach is called the "real time two way direct load control algorithm" (RTDLCA), which finds the suitable central air conditioning customers to control by integer programming. The RTDLCA calculates the follow up load to shed based on the monitored air conditioning load and minimizes the difference between the load planned to be shed and the real load has been shed. The time lagging of load variations of every chiller under control as well as load profiles being sent back via broad band network is considered and is signified in RTDLCA.
